NORTH DAKOTA BOARD OF HIGHER EDUCATION Left to Right, Seated: Albert Haas, Mrs. Elvira Jestrab, Mrs. Mildred Johnson, and John Conrad, 1’reslde Sullivan, Fred Orth, Martin Kruse, Commissioner Kenneth Raschke, Assistant Commissioner Lloyd Nygaard. Dickinson State College and all other state-supported higher education institu- tions in North Dakota are under the gen- eral administration and direction of the State Board of Higher Education. The sev- en members of this board are appointed by the Governor for staggered terms. Nor- mally only one member is appointed to the Board each year. They hold regular monthly meetings to pass on recommendations made by the college presidents, determine budgets, approve payrolls, and approve building and major repair projects.

PRESIDENT’S OFFICE The year 1964-65 was a year to be remembered at Dickinson State College, but only those who were a part of DSC's expanding, thriving, fomenting environ- ment that year will remember with any clarity the people and events which made DSC history in 1964-65. Consequently, it is good that Prairie Smoke preserves life as it was at Dickinson State College in its 47th year. In the pages of this annual the students and staff of 1964-65 are pictured for posterity as they were in that event- filled year; the activities and accomplish- ments of students in 1964-65 are recorded here as they enlarged the ever-expanding environment for learning, which is Dickinson State College. O. A. DeLong, President Mrs. Laura Lagge Secretary to Mr. DeLong 7
